Statue of Emperor Franz I., Burggarten, Vienna
1

Statue of Emperor Franz I., Burggarten, Vienna

A bronze statue in classicist forms, depicting Emperor Franz I Stephen on horseback, was constructed by Balthasar Ferdinand Moll and completed in 1781.

Albertina
2

Albertina

A museum housing one of the largest and most important print rooms in the world, featuring approximately 65,000 drawings and 1 million old master prints, as well as modern graphic works, photographs, and architectural drawings.

Austrian Film Museum
3

Austrian Film Museum

A cinematheque, the Austrian Film Museum is a research and educational facility dedicated to the preservation and presentation of films, with Honorary President Martin Scorsese and a history of hosting prominent filmmakers since 1964.

Imperial Treasury
4

Imperial Treasury

A museum containing a valuable collection of secular and ecclesiastical treasures covering over a thousand years of European history, featuring the Imperial Regalia, Austrian Crown Jewels, and other precious items, including jewelry, relics, and objects ascribed to the private ownership of saints.

Natural History Museum, Vienna
9

Natural History Museum, Vienna

A natural history museum created by Emperor Franz Joseph I, opened to the public in 1889, featuring four autonomous departments: mineralogical-petrographical, geological-paleontological, herpetological, and entomological.
